Key Responsibilities
Customer Service (60%)
Provide outstanding service and support to a high volume of calls and emails from individuals, schools, groups and affiliated professionals.
Handle course registrations from initial inquiry to course completion.
Fulfill requests for course and marketing materials.
Manage course billing inquiries, registrations, payment plans, and scholarships.
Course Management (20%)
Set up, maintain and update all aspects of online course offerings.
Monitor and track course completion across multiple training offerings; monitor and track course evaluations, where appropriate
Handle scheduling of Mindful Schools courses and special events.
Coordinate the training calendar and logistics for training delivery such as scheduling workshops, supporting material preparation, managing the participant list, and monitoring the training team mailbox
Find venues and manage logistics for in-person courses.
General Administration (20%)
Update and maintain accurate records in the salesforce CRM
Work with Director on special projects as needed.
